My story

Here's what the humans have to say about me:

Pudding and her sister Frances were found abandoned on the streets. They look like an australian shepherd/cattle dog/heeler mix. They can be adopted separately. Pudding has the most beautiful blue merle coloring and the prettiest face. Each one loves to come put their front paws in your lap so they can get a hug and lots of ear rubs.

Puddin and Frances love to play. They like to be outside, so would enjoy going to dog parks, or walks...probably would love trails and hiking. They seem happiest when they get a lot of outdoor activity.

They definitely have heeler in them...they love to herd you .I do think the dogs would love kids and their energy....but probably kids age 10 or older. We are working on their manners, in that they like to jump on you....they are getting better

They use the doggie door and we haven't had an accident in the house in quite a while. They love the other dogs and seem to get along with any dog we have brought in the house. They especially love little dogs who they play with very gently .

Puddin is currently 35lbs at 9/15. We think these two will be in the 50-60 lb range...not what I would consider a small dog, but I think it's a great size for kids. Both dogs are approximately 6 months old at September 1, 2015. Puddin is going to be smaller than Frances. They do not need to be adopted together!!

If you live in MA, there are new requirements for rescue dogs - according to the State Law, all rescues have to be quarantined for 48 hrs at the Ben Elder Kennels in Westport, MA. There is additional cost for this quarantine and new required health cert by a licensed MA vet of $110. We will go over all fees with you via email. Also, The state of MA does not allow adoptions of dogs that are heart worm positive. We are required to do a foster to adopt until the dog tests heart worm negative, usually in 4-6 months after treatment.
